Vide, hvordan man importerer en Microsoft Excel-regneark til en Visual Basic-program er godt kendskab til at have , når man arbejder med flere regneark. Microsoft Visual Basic er nemt at lære at udvikle Windows-programmer. I Visual Basic.NET er data Netoversigt kontrol almindeligvis anvendes til at vise Excel-regneark information til en bruger. Du kan også bruge dataene i Grid View kontrol for yderligere data manipulation i din ansøgning . Ting du skal
Microsoft Office Excel 2007
Microsoft Visual Basic 2010 Express
Vis Flere Instruktioner
1
Start Microsoft Excel 2007 og skriv " Felt A" i A1 og " Field B" i A2.Type " a2 " i A2 , " a3 " i A3 , " a4 " i A4 og " a5 " i A5.Type " b2 " i B2, " b3 " i B3, " b4 " . i B4 og " b5 " i B5
Gem dit regneark til C: . \\ som " importToGrid.xlsx " (uden anførselstegn)
2
Start Microsoft Visual Basic 2010 Express og vælg " Nyt projekt ... " fra menuen "Filer" . Vælg "Windows Forms Application ", og klik på " OK. "
Tryk på " Ctrl + Alt + X " for at åbne menuen "Funktioner" . Dobbeltklik på " Button " og " DataGridView " for at tilføje disse kontroller til " Form1 ". Dobbeltklik på " Button1 " for at åbne " Form1.vb "-modulet .
3
Type " . import System.Data.OleDb "i første linje af " Form1.vb " til reference
4
Skriv følgende at erklære din datasæt og tilslutning variabler : Hej
Dim datasæt As New DataSet ( ) Dim connString As String = " Provider = Microsoft.ACE.OLEDB.12.0 , datakilde = C: \\ importToGrid.xlsx ; " & _ "Extended Properties = Excel 12,0 , "
< br > 5
Skriv følgende at forespørge data fra Ark1 i dit regneark : Hej
Dim XLData Som Nye OleDbDataAdapter ( "SELECT * FROM [ Ark1 $] " , connString )
< br > 6.
Skriv følgende for at oprette en tabel i din data Adapter variable : Hej
XLData.TableMappings.Add ( "Tabel" , " mySpreadataSetheet " ) XLData.Fill ( datasæt)
< br > 7.
Skriv følgende for at vise regnearksdata i din data Netoversigt kontrol :
Me.DataGridView1.DataSource = dataSet.Tables ( " mySpreadataSetheet " ) Me.Refresh ()
8
Tryk på " F5 " for at køre dit program og klik på " Button1 " for at importere regnearket og se den i din data Netoversigt kontrol.